The Contact-Free Sleep Monitoring Systems Market comprises innovative, non-intrusive devices designed to track and analyze sleep patterns without direct contact with the user. These systems utilize advanced sensors such as radar, infrared, or acoustic technologies to monitor vital signs, movement, breathing, and heart rate remotely. They are primarily used in healthcare settings, smart homes, and personal wellness environments to provide continuous, real-time sleep data. The market is characterized by a convergence of IoT, AI-driven analytics, and user-centric design, enabling enhanced sleep quality assessment and health management. As a result, these systems are transforming traditional sleep diagnostics by offering scalable, user-friendly solutions that cater to diverse consumer needs.

Despite promising growth, the market faces challenges such as concerns over data privacy and cybersecurity, which may hinder consumer trust and adoption. High costs associated with advanced contact-free systems can limit accessibility, especially in emerging markets. The lack of standardized regulatory guidelines across regions creates barriers to widespread deployment and acceptance. Additionally, technological limitations in accurately capturing sleep metrics in diverse environments and populations can impact system reliability. Resistance from traditional sleep clinics and healthcare providers accustomed to conventional diagnostics also poses a hurdle to market expansion. Lastly, interoperability issues among various devices and platforms can impede seamless integration into existing health ecosystems.
